About Renzo Trivelli

  • Renzo Trivelli (3 May 1925 – 30 November 2015) was an Italian politician.
  • He was a member of the Italian Communist Party and the Democratic Left Party.
  • In 1956, he succeeded Enrico Berlinguer as leader of the Italian Communist Youth Federation, a position he held until 1960. He was elected to the European Parliament in 1984, and then re-elected in 1989, to the lists of the PCI.
  • He was vice president of the Delegation for relations with Hungary.
  • After that, he was on the Committee on Development and Cooperation, the Delegation for relations with the Member States of ASEAN and the ASEAN Inter-Parliamentary Organization (AIPO).
  • In 1993, Trivelli became a part of the Delegation to the EC-Turkey Joint Parliamentary Committee.
  • In 1994, Trivelli was elected to the Committee on Foreign Affairs and Security.Trivelli died on 30 November 2015.
